Treatment options for ADHD / ADD

There are many private treatment options available for ADHD / ADD. Medication is often a major part of the treatment, however, non-medication therapies can assist. These include counseling, family therapy and cognitive behavioral therapy and family therapy. All can help people learn to manage their symptoms and live more efficiently.

Combining therapy and medication is usually the best choice for adults. Although medications may be stimulating, side effects such as depression, insomnia, anxiety or mood swings may occur. It is crucial to discuss the risks of taking medication with your physician prior to you decide to take it.

Stimulants are one of the most sought-after treatments for adhd disorder treatment norwich/ADD. Stimulants can help improve focus, concentration, and hyperactivity. They can be addictive. They can also cause heart ailments. Like other medicines it is crucial to keep track of the heart rate, blood pressure, and other health symptoms. Some people have trouble adapting to stimulants, so they might need to gradually increase their doses.

Another kind of medication used to treat ADHD is the antidepressant. They are the best choice for people who are unable to take stimulants or suffer from severe side effects. GABA, an amino acid that stops nerve cells from overfiring, is an alternative treatment option. This substance can also be used to treat anxiety and improve memory.

Common symptoms of ADHD

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) can be difficult to recognize. In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ity are some of the most frequent symptoms of ADHD. These symptoms can impact the performance of a student as well as daily life. It is essential to speak with an experienced doctor if your adult or child is experiencing any of these symptoms. A diagnosis can lead to better treatment and accommodations.

While the signs of ADHD may vary from individual to individual however, there are a few common traits that are seen in most patients. Inattention is a problem when it comes to continuous attention which can be difficult for the sufferer and those around them. Many people suffering from ADHD have a hard time being focused on one aspect, like engaging in a conversation.

Children can have emotional outbursts or impulsive behavior, and these issues can be hard to control. If these issues are not addressed and treated they could get worse over time.
